笔者的学习环境--在VMware虚拟机下安装四个CentOS系统(搭建Hadoop集群用),其中一个为Master,三个为Slave,Master作为Hadoop集群中的NameNode,三个Slave作为DataNode。同时我们将四个CentOS系统的IP设置为静态,防止IP变化而导致集群不可用(IP变化了,就得修改配置才能使用Hadoop集群了)
2.安装VMware
VMware Workstation Pro 12.1.1 Build 3770994发布下载
下载完毕后双击运行,然后想安装其他软件一样一直点击下一步,即可完成安装。安装位置可以修改一下,笔者安装目录是: D:\developer\VMware Workstation。
3.安装CentOS
下面我们开始安装CentOS系统,笔者这里选择的是CentOS6.7 32位系统,提供一下下载地址:.下载完成后我们开始安装。
3.1. 这里就不截图了,打开我们安装好的VMware,点击新建虚拟机,选择典型(推荐)(T),下一步,这里学习一下CentOS的安装,下面就不选择VMware的自动安装了,直接选择稍后安装操作系统,再下一步选择操作系统类型,选择linux,版本选择CentOS即可(如果是安装64位的CentOS选择CentOS 64位),点击下一步选择安装位置和名称,这里笔者将名称修改为HadoopMaster(其他三台安装时分别改为HadoopSlave1,HadoopSlave2,HadoopSlave3),位置统一安装在了D:\developer\Virtual Machines\目录下(安装位置和名称可以自行修改),之后的步骤一直使用默认选项即可,即一直点击下一步完成安装。
3.2. 调整虚拟机设置,可以编辑内存和处理器等信息,CentOS6以上系统建议选择内存大于632MB,笔者选择1024MB,即1GB。继续选择CD/DVD,默认单选按钮选择的是使用物理启动器,这里改为使用ISO镜像文件,并选择下载好的CentOS-6.7-i386-bin-DVD1.iso所在位置。网络适配器改为桥接模式,桥接模式可以和局域网内所有电脑通信,建议选择此模式。
3.3 点击开启虚拟机,进入CentOS安装界面,选择第一项之后就是如下图所示界面
3.4. 选择skip,跳过测试,直接进行安装
3.5. 界面出现后点击下一步,语言选择English>U.S.English,点击下一步
3.6.
选择安装的存储设备,选择基础存储设备Basic storage Devices,点击下一步,会询问是否丢弃数据,因为我们是新装系统,选择Yes丢弃数据,之后就是配置主机名,直接使用默认的,所以我们还是选择下一步
3.7.接下来选择时区,我是中国人,在下拉列表中选择Asia/Shanghai就行了,当然,知道地图上的位置也可以点击位置选中上海,再次点击下一步